PROCEDURE
实验过程
To an ice cold solution of 0.44 g (1.4 mmol) of 4-(4-hydroxy-butyl)-5-oxo-[1,4]diazepane-1-carboxylic acid benzyl ester in 5 ml of acetonitrile:water (1:1) was added 0.043 g (0.3 mmol) TEMPO and 0.97 g (3.0 mmol) of (diacetoxyiodo)benzene. The mixture was stirred allowed to reach room temperature and was stirred for a further 3 h after which time it was evaporated to dryness. The crude residue was redissolved in 5 ml of DMF, 0.68 g (2 mmol) of HATU and 0.6 ml (4.0 mmol) of triethylamine added followed by addition of 0.25 g (2.0 mmol) of (S)-6-aza-spiro[2.5]octan-4-ol. hydrochloride (intermediate 2). The reaction was stirred for 16 h after which time the mixture was poured onto sat. aq. NaHCO3, extracted with EtOAc. The combined organic phases were washed with brine, dried (Na2SO4) and concentrated. Purification on a SiO2-column (CH2Cl2/MeOH 95:5), afforded the titled compound in 55% yield as a colorless foam. MS: 444.3 (MH+).
